Ticket: Driftpane diff viewer fails on files over 40MB in prod-eu. Cause: env misconfig — chunking service URL points at the retired sandbox host. Support: advise affected users it's server-side, no client fix. Ops will rebuild the env file with the correct chunker endpoint and redeploy. The chunker also needs its API secret, which goes on the following line.

secret setting of hawep-yahig: LEDGER_TOKEN29=41b5d6315371c92885eaeb077fb63

v3.8.0 — TerraNote field-survey app. Renamed OFFLINE_CACHE_ON to OFFLINE_MODE_ENABLED for clarity; old name is ignored as of this release. Offline bundles now sync on reconnect without a manual flush. Update local env files accordingly. The sync service still requires its auth token, which should be placed on the line following this entry.

vault entry, yahaf-tagug: LEDGER_TOKEN20=884d77d1a8b98aa4edfb

Memo to Finance — Pelbrook pilot update. Quick one: our pilot with the Greywick Market retail chain kicks off next month across six of their stores. We're fronting fixture costs, recovered via a revenue share, so expect a short-term dip in the pilot cost centre. Tansy Oduya will send the accrual schedule. Flag any modelling concerns early. Confidential note on the wider plan sits below.

confidential, kagep-kahof: Druokax Systems plans to lower the Ulaath list price by 53 percent in March.

## Runbook: SplitSpan assignment service

SplitSpan hands out experiment arms at the edge. If assignment latency exceeds 50ms or arm ratios skew beyond tolerance, first check the bucketing cache; a cold cache after deploys causes temporary skew that self-heals in ten minutes. Do not restart both replicas at once — that wipes sticky assignments. Before any intervention, confirm the live process matches the configuration below.

config for kawif-hahig:
zorix:
  log_level: error
  metrics_host: metrics.zorix.lumiclabs.internal
  pool_size: 16

TURN-208: Gatevale turnstile counters at the Merrow Field pilot double-count when a rotation reverses mid-cycle. Attendance totals drift roughly 2% high per event. The debounce window fix is implemented, reviewed by Ilsa, and soak-tested across two simulated match days without drift. Ready for your cut; the candidate build is identified below.

trace token, tagag-tafog: htk6_5ed18c